Quick Answer

U0784 means: U0784 indicates a communication failure between control modules in your vehicle.

Fix: Check and replace faulty components Cost: $150 - $500 Time: 90-180 minutes

Can I drive with U0784? Immediate attention is recommended to avoid further complications.

Common Questions

What does U0784 mean and how does it affect my car?

U0784 indicates a problem with communication between control modules in your vehicle. This can affect the performance of critical systems, leading to erratic behavior, reduced functionality, and even safety risks. Addressing this code promptly is essential to maintain your vehicle’s performance.

What are the most common causes of U0784 and how much does it cost to fix?

Common causes include wiring issues (40% likelihood), faulty control modules (30%), and software glitches (20%). Repair costs range from $50 for software updates to over $1,200 for control module replacements, depending on the issue's severity.

Can I drive my car with U0784 or should I stop immediately?

While you may be able to drive your vehicle with the U0784 code, it is not advisable due to the potential for compromised safety and performance. It's best to have the issue diagnosed and repaired as soon as possible to avoid further complications.

How can I diagnose U0784 myself using GeekOBD APP?

Using the GeekOBD APP, you can perform a complete scan of your vehicle's OBD2 system. Look for the U0784 code, review freeze-frame data for context, and check for other related codes that may provide insight into the issue.

What vehicles are most commonly affected by U0784?

U0784 is frequently seen in various Ford models, particularly the 2015-2018 Ford F-150, as well as other vehicles with complex electronic systems. Checking for recalls or technical service bulletins (TSBs) related to your specific model can be beneficial.

How can I prevent U0784 from happening again?

Regular maintenance, including checking electrical connections and keeping software updated, can help prevent U0784. Additionally, addressing any electrical issues promptly can mitigate the risk of future communication errors.

What is U0784?

DTC U0784 is a diagnostic trouble code that indicates a communication issue between the vehicle's control modules. More specifically, it suggests that there is a problem with the communication link to the Electronic Control Unit (ECU) or a related module within the vehicle's network. This code is particularly common in several Ford vehicles, including popular models like the 2015-2018 Ford F-150. When this code triggers, it typically means that the modules are unable to share information effectively, which can lead to various issues affecting the vehicle's performance and functionality. Drivers may experience symptoms such as the check engine light illuminating, erratic performance, or even failure of some electronic components. Since modern vehicles rely heavily on multiple control modules working together, a U0784 code can have serious implications, including potential safety concerns if critical systems are affected. If you encounter this code, it’s essential to address it promptly to ensure your vehicle operates safely and efficiently.

System: U - Network (Communication, CAN Bus)

Symptoms

Common symptoms when U0784 is present:

  • Check engine light stays on constantly, indicating that the vehicle's computer has detected a persistent issue.
  • Engine may hesitate or stall during acceleration, which can affect overall driving safety.
  • Fuel economy decreased by 10-15%, as the vehicle may not be operating efficiently due to communication errors.
  • Loss of functionality in electronic features such as power windows or infotainment system glitches.
  • Unexpected warning lights may appear on the dashboard, indicating further electronic issues.

Possible Causes

Most common causes of U0784 (ordered by frequency):

  1. Wiring issues or damaged connectors: This is the most common cause, accounting for about 40% of cases. Corroded connectors can disrupt communication between modules.
  2. Faulty control modules: Approximately 30% of U0784 occurrences stem from malfunctioning modules that fail to communicate properly with each other.
  3. Software glitches: Around 20% of the time, outdated or corrupt software can cause communication failures in the vehicle's network, which can often be resolved with a software update.
  4. Less common but serious cause includes severe electrical system failures, such as short circuits or complete module failures, which may require extensive repairs.
  5. Rare causes involve factory recalls or service bulletins related to specific models, necessitating professional intervention.

U0784 Repair Costs

Cost Breakdown by Repair Type

Wiring Repair or Replacement

Repairing or replacing damaged wiring or connectors related to the communication network.

  • Total: $150 - $500
  • Success rate: 85%
Control Module Replacement

Replacing a faulty control module that fails to communicate with other modules.

  • Total: $300 - $1,200
  • Success rate: 90%
Software Update

Updating the vehicle's software to fix potential bugs causing the communication error.

  • Total: $50 - $150
  • Success rate: 70%
Money-Saving Tips for U0784
  • Start with the most common and least expensive repairs first
  • Use GeekOBD APP to confirm diagnosis before replacing expensive parts
  • Consider preventive maintenance to avoid future occurrences
  • Compare prices for OEM vs aftermarket parts based on your needs
  • Address the issue promptly to prevent more expensive secondary damage

Diagnostic Steps

Professional U0784 Diagnosis Process

Follow these systematic steps to accurately diagnose U0784. Each step builds on the previous one to ensure accurate diagnosis.

Step 1: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es)

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ion (5-10 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 2: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es)

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es and freeze frame data to understand the fault context (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 3: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components (20-30 minutes)

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components (20-30 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 4: Step 4: System function test - Verify proper operation after repairs and clear codes (10-15 minutes)

Step 4: System function test - Verify proper operation after repairs and clear codes (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success (15-20 minutes)

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success (15-20 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.

Important Notes

  • Always verify the repair with GeekOBD APP after completing diagnostic steps
  • Clear codes and test drive to ensure the problem is resolved
  • Address underlying causes to prevent code recurrence

Real Repair Case Studies

Case Study 1: 2016 Ford F-150 U0784 Code Resolution

Vehicle: 2016 Ford F-150, 75,000 miles

Problem: Customer reported check engine light and poor acceleration performance.

Diagnosis: Scanned vehicle with GeekOBD APP, retrieved U0784 code, and noted corroded connectors.

Solution: Replaced corroded connectors and cleared codes.

Cost: $300 (parts and labor included)

Result: Check engine light turned off, and vehicle performance returned to normal.

Case Study 2: 2017 Ford Explorer U0784 Diagnosis

Vehicle: 2017 Ford Explorer, 50,000 miles

Problem: Customer experienced intermittent electrical issues and dashboard warning lights.

Diagnosis: Used GeekOBD APP to identify U0784 along with additional codes indicating a faulty control module.

Solution: Replaced the faulty control module and updated software.

Cost: $800 (includes new module and software update)

Result: All electrical systems functioned properly, and all warning lights were resolved.

Diagnose U0784

Use GeekOBD APP for professional diagnosis!

  • Real-time data monitoring
  • Advanced diagnostic features
  • Step-by-step repair guidance
  • Professional-grade analysis

Code Information

Code: U0784
System: Network (Communication, CAN Bus)
Severity: HIGH
Category: Network Codes